How Wagering Works
Wagering requirements determine how many times you must play through bonus funds before withdrawing. For example, a 100% match bonus of $100 with a 35x wagering requirement means you need to wager $100 × 35 = $3,500 before cashing out. If the bonus also includes a max withdrawal cap of 10x the bonus, the maximum you can withdraw is $1,000. Let’s break it down:
Important: Always check the wagering contribution of games – slots usually cont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10% or even 0%.
Formula: Wagering Requirement = Bonus Amount × Wagering Multiplier. Then calculate expected loss: House Edge × Total Wagered. For example, with a 97% RTP slot (3% house edge), the expected loss on $3,500 wagered is $3,500 × 0.03 = $105. So net expected gain after fulfilling wagering is $100 (bonus) – $105 = -$5, meaning you might lose part of your deposit. Always factor in the house edge.
Is It Safe?
Before depositing, ensure the casino holds a valid license from a reputable authority like the UK Gambling Commission or Malta Gaming Authority. Look for SSL encryption (padlock in browser) and independent audits of RNG games. Also read player reviews about payout reliability.
Deposits & Withdrawals
Navigate to the cashier and select your preferred payment method. Common options include credit/debit cards, e-wallets (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and cryptocurrencies. Deposits are usually instant, while withdrawals take 1-5 business days for e-wallets, up to 10 days for bank transfers. Minimum withdrawal is typically $20. Remember to use the same method for deposit and withdrawal if required.
Extra Tips
Compare deposit and withdrawal speeds to choose the best method for you.
| Payment Method | Deposit Speed | Withdrawal Speed |
|---|---|---|
| E-wallet (e.g., Skrill) | Instant | 24-48 hours |
| Credit/Debit Card | Instant | 3-5 business days |
| Bank Transfer | 1-3 days | 5-10 business days |
| Cryptocurrency | 10-30 minutes | 1-24 hours |
